AEW Fyter Fest night two live results: Jericho vs. Orange Cassidy

Fyter Fest continues tonight on TNT. 

Orange Cassidy vs. Chris Jericho will headline night two of the event. Their feud was set in motion when Jericho and The Inner Circle beat Cassidy down with a bag of blood oranges. Cassidy got a measure of revenge a week later when he cost Jericho and Sammy Guevara a shot at the AEW Tag Team titles. The two had a strong brawl two weeks ago on Dynamite and a pull-apart on night one of Fyter Fest last week. 

Kenny Omega and Hangman Page will defend their AEW World Tag Team Championships against Private Party. Omega and Page successfully defended their titles last week against Best Friends, while Private Party defeated Santana and Ortiz a week ago to earn the title shot. 

The Young Bucks will be in action this evening, teaming with FTR. They will take on The Butcher, The Blade, Pentagon Jr. and Rey Fenix in an eight-man tag. 

Colt Cabana will team with Mr. Brodie Lee and Stu Grayson against the SCU trio of Christopher Daniels, Frankie Kazarian and Scorpio Sky. 

A major announcement from Taz and Brian Cage has been advertised for the show as well. Cage was originally scheduled to challenge Jon Moxley for the AEW World Championship tonight, but that match has been pushed to next week’s Fight for the Fallen. 

Lance Archer vs. Joey Janela and Nyla Rose in action have also been advertised for tonight’s show.

AEW World Tag Team Championship match: Hangman Page & Kenny Omega defeated Private Party (w/Matt Hardy) to retain the titles

This was a great opener. 

Omega and Marq Quen kicked things off. Quen used a headscissors takedown and a trip takedown to set up a standing moonsault attempt. Omega got his knees up to cut Quen off. Page and Omega hit a series of chops. 

Page hit a fall-away slam with a bridge for a two count. Omega missed a kotaro krusher. Isiah Kassidy tagged in to hit the silly string on Omega. Page and Quen brawled on the floor where Page threw Quen over the barricade. Kassidy hit a spectacular springboard dive to the floor.

All four guys jumped in as the match broke down. Quen and Kassidy hit a double Spanish fly on Omega for a near fall. Kassidy got another near fall off a backbreaker. Page blind tagged himself in and powerbombed Quen on top of Kassidy. 

Kassidy hit a moonsault off the post to Omega on the floor. Kassidy cut Page off as he went for a Buckshot Lariat on Quen and nailed him with a flatliner on the stage. Quen hit a shooting star press on Page but Omega broke up the pin at the last possible instant. 

Omega and Page blocked the Gin ‘n’ Juice. Omega sent Quen outside with a v-trigger. 

Omega and Page then hit the Last Call on Kassidy and Page scored the pinfall.

Lance Archer (w/Jake Roberts) defeated Joey Janela

Archer entered with Janela’s tag partner Sonny Kiss in a fireman’s carry on his shoulders. Archer launched Kiss into Janela. Janela came back with a dive off the post. 

Janela set up a table on the outside. He then grabbed a chair and climbed to the top rope. The referee took the chair away which gave Archer time to recover. Archer hit a pounce, then targeted Janela’s back with stomps. 

You could see welts forming on Janela’s back and chest from the force of Archer’s blows. Archer continued working Janela over as the show went to a commercial break.

After the break, Janela was making a comeback with clotheslines. Archer didn’t leave his feet. Archer went for Blackout. Janela countered into an elbow drop for a near fall. 

Roberts jumped on the apron with a snake bag and took the ref. Janela hit Archer with a senton. Kiss hit a 450 splash. Janela covered for a two count. 

Archer hit Blackout through the table that Janela had set up earlier. Archer threw Janela inside and pinned him.

Tony Schiavone went to the ring and introduced Taz and Brian Cage. 

Taz brought a black bag to the ring. He said what was in the bag was something he created years ago with his blood, sweat and tears, the FTW World Championship. 

Taz said no promotion has ever recognized the FTW title but fans around the world recognize that whoever holds that title is the baddest son of a bitch on the planet. Taz said Cage is no longer uncrowned, he’s the new FTW champion. 

Taz said the FTW Championship is some renegade sh**. He said Cage is the FTW Champion and will soon be the AEW Champion too.

The Butcher, The Blade, Pentagon Jr. & Rey Fenix defeated The Young Bucks & FTR

This was an incredible match. If they wanted to go the rest of the show I would have been fine with it. 

Penta and Nick started off but Penta demanded that Harwood tag in. Harwood and Wheeler went after Pentagon’s left arm. Pentagon came back with kicks to Harwood. Pentagon hit a double stomp off the top. Fenix tagged in for a springboard kick and a one count. 

Things descended into chaos. This was just all action. The Bucks doubled up and hit tandem dropkicks and superkicks. Butcher and Blade jumped in and cut off the Bucks. FTR made the save for the Bucks. 

Fenix and Nick Jackson ended up the legal men. Nick hit a super frankensteiner for a near fall. Wheeler jumped in and hit a dragon suplex. Finally the heels cut off Wheeler and worked him over through a commercial break. 

Matt got a tag and ran wild with a double high cross. He hit a standing sliced bread on Fenix. He hit a dive off the post to Butcher and Blade. Matt hit a top rope elbow on Fenix for a two count. 

Harwood blind tagged in and hit a DDT on Blade. Harwood and Matt hit tandem superkicks. Wheeler and Nick hit a Goodnight Express. Harwood and Wheeler went for a spike piledriver on Blade. Butcher saved. Nick completed the spike piledriver. Harwood covered but got pulled out of the ring. 

Harwood and Matt hit a tandem superplex. Wheeler hit a springboard splash. Nick hit a swanton bomb. Pentagon broke up a pin. 

Matt and Pentagon ended up the legal men. Fenix hit a springboard destroyer on Nick off the second rope to the floor. That was insane. 

The finish saw Matt accidentally hit Harwood with a kick. Pentagon and Fenix hit Matt with the fire driver for the pin.

Nyla Rose defeated KiLynn King & Kenzie Paige

Rose won a squash after hitting a Beast Bomb on Paige and pinning both Paige and King at the same time. 

**********

Rose cut a promo after the match. She said that actions speak louder than words and her actions spoke loudly here tonight. She then proceeded to say more words. 

Rose said she sees all these great wrestlers in AEW with managers and most of them have titles. She said she’s going to have a manager but she’s not ready to say who it is yet. 

Rose turned her attention to Hikaru Shida in the crowd. She said the manager will ensure that she will leave AEW with Hikaru Shida’s title very soon.

Mr. Brodie Lee, Colt Cabana & Stu Grayson defeated Scorpio Sky, Frankie Kazarian & Christopher Daniels

This was a good match and the story of Cabana slowly embracing Dark Order is growing on me. 

Grayson and Daniels started out. Grayson got some offense before Daniels cut him off. Kazarian tagged in and hit a release German suplex for a two count. 

Cabana and Sky tagged in. Cabana sold his ribs as Sky grabbed him. Lee began yelling at Cabana from the apron as if he was angry that Cabana was showing weakness. 

Dark Order provided a distraction from the stage. Lee jumped in and cut Sky off. Lee, Grayson and Cabana took turns working Sky over through a commercial break. 

After the break, Lee slammed Sky. Grayson hit a splash off the top for a two count. Sky came back with a kick to Cabana’s ribs and a neckbreaker. 

Kazarian and Lee got tags. Kazarian hit a one-legged dropkick, blocked a boss man slam and hit a springboard DDT. Lee hoisted Kazarian up. Daniels hit him with a missile dropkick and Kazarian covered for a near fall. 

Kazarian hit Grayson with a slingshot cutter. Lee hit a boss man slam on Kazarian. Daniels hit a tope suicida to Lee. Daniels hit Grayson with a moonsault but Cabana broke up the pin. 

Lee jumped in and hit Daniels with a discus lariat. He then ordered Grayson to tag in Cabana to cover Daniels for the pin.

Chris Jericho (w/Santana & Ortiz) defeated Orange Cassidy

This was a hell of a main event. 

Cassidy ran wild at the outset. He hit a suicide dive and whipped Jericho into the barricade. Excalibur pointed out on commentary that Jericho hurt the arm he uses for the Judas Effect on a shot into the barricade. 

Back inside, Jericho cut Cassidy off and put him in the Walls. Cassidy reached the ropes for a break but Jericho had turned the tide. Cassidy took a mad ball shot from Santana and Ortiz from the floor. 

Cassidy used three quick cradles for near falls. Cassidy missed a superman punch and rolled outside. Jericho hit him with a baseball slide . Jericho worked Cassidy over through a commercial break. 

Cassidy came back with a headscissors takeover and his short kicks before winding up and hitting a real superkick for a two count. Cassidy blocked a superplex and hit a top rope splash for a near fall. 

Jericho missed a dive to the apron and fell to the floor. Cassidy hit a springboard dive. Cassidy threw Jericho back in and hit a diving DDT off the top for a two count. 

Cassidy called for a superman punch. Jericho caught him coming in and used the Walls. Cassidy turned the hold into a cradle for a near fall. Cassidy hit a superman punch. 

Santana and Ortiz threw orange juice in Cassidy’s face. Best Friends ran in and brawled into the crowd with them. Jericho used a baseball bat shot on Cassdy with the ref distracted but Cassidy kicked out. 

Jericho hit a back elbow. Cassidy hit a Michinoku Driver for a two count. They traded strikes. Cassidy hit a Stundog Millionaire and a tornado DDT for a near fall. 

Cassidy went for a superman punch but ran right into the Judas Effect and Jericho pinned him.
